Safety Standards
In the UK, specific security guidelines need to be met for bathroom lighting installation. Look for lighting fixtures that comply with the IET Wiring Regulations (BS 7671) and are ranked for use in wet or wet areas. This is essential for fixtures positioned near sinks or showers.
2. IP Ratings
The Ingress Protection (IP) ranking suggests how resistant a component is to moisture. Restrooms generally require lights with an IP rating of a minimum of IP44 to guarantee security from splashes of water.
IP20: Not ideal for restroomsIP44: Suitable for zone 2 locationsIP65: Suitable for zone 1, can be utilized in shower enclosures3. Design and Aesthetics

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. What is the very best lighting for a little bathroom?
In little bathrooms, it is advisable to utilize brilliant ambient lighting integrated with job lighting around mirrors. Wall sconces or mirror lights can save area while supplying needed lighting.
2. Can I use standard lights in the bathroom?
It is crucial to utilize lighting fixtures specifically created for bathrooms due to wetness and humidity. Guarantee they have adequate IP scores for security.
3. How high should I set up bathroom sconces?
Bathroom sconces must preferably be installed around eye level, generally about 60-66 inches from the [Floor Lamps UK](https://peopletopeople.tv/members/carerice6/activity/424886/) to efficiently illuminate the face without casting shadows.
4. What color temperature level is best for bathroom lighting?
A color temperature level between 2700K to 3000K is preferable, as it offers warm, welcoming light that complements complexion and produces a peaceful environment.
5. Is it needed to have a dimmer switch in the bathroom?
While not essential, dimmer switches can improve flexibility, allowing users to adjust lighting levels according to jobs and activities, which can be especially beneficial in a multi-functional space.
